Product Introduction

Overview

The BC51PASX is a medium power PNP bipolar junction transistor (BJT) manufactured by NXP Semiconductors, now part of Nexperia. This transistor is designed for a variety of applications requiring high current and voltage handling capabilities. It features a compact surface mount DFN2020D-3 package, making it suitable for space-constrained designs. The BC51PASX is known for its reliability and performance in medium power applications.

Key Specifications

Parameter Value
Collector-Emitter Voltage (Vce) 45 V
Collector Current (Ic) 1 A
Collector-Emitter Saturation Voltage (Vce(sat)) 500 mV
Power Dissipation (Pd) 420 mW
Gain Bandwidth Product (fT) 145 MHz
Minimum Operating Temperature -55 °C
Maximum Operating Temperature 150 °C
Package Type DFN2020D-3 (Surface Mount)

Key Features

  • High collector current of 1 A and collector-emitter voltage of 45 V, making it suitable for medium power applications.
  • Low collector-emitter saturation voltage (Vce(sat)) of 500 mV, which reduces power losses.
  • High gain bandwidth product (fT) of 145 MHz, enabling high-frequency operation.
  • Compact DFN2020D-3 surface mount package for space-efficient designs.
  • Wide operating temperature range from -55 °C to 150 °C, ensuring reliability in various environments.
